Description
Jumpstart your coding journey with Python Programming for Beginners, the ultimate guide for newcomers to programming! This book is designed to make learning Python easy, engaging, and accessible. Covering everything from basic syntax to creating your own simple programs, Python Programming for Beginners provides clear explanations, real-world examples, and hands-on exercises that empower you to start coding confidently.
